Just an update. I just handled my 416 again, it was unused about a week or 2 since i'm busy at work.

 

For the mag height issue, I've fix mine, hopefuly the issue wont come back. What I did was file some part of atleast the three teeth (upper part) of the barrel extension as what suggested by nugentgl. It's because the nozzle was pushed upward a bit when the mag was inserted, then the nozzle hood will tightly touch the upper part of the barrel extension.
